I make merch and kept hitting the same wall - I'd have a specific shape in mind and a specific piece of text I wanted *inside* it, but every app I tried either couldn't do that exact thing or did it badly: ugly fonts, no real control, no way to style certain words differently.
After wishing the tool existed enough times, I just built it. The first design I made with it ended up selling really well, which was the nudge I needed to clean it up and share.
What it does:
• Upload any PNG, type your text, pick a font
• Multiple flow patterns: horizontal, spiral, zigzag, follow the shape's edge
• Word-frequency scaling (like a word cloud)
• Brightness-aware text that adds depth to portraits and photos
• Per-word styling (font, size, color, rotation) for the words you want to pop
• Runs in the browser, exports high-res
